An agent is a member, not a feature
Most products bolt an assistant onto the side, a box in the corner with no standing in the thing it is helping you with. Brainstorm makes an agent a member of your vault instead, with a name, permissions from the same list a person holds, and a record of everything it did.

An app can be two files
The whole platform contract is a manifest and an entry page, so you can extend your own workspace with a tool nobody else would ever build, typed by hand in the code editor or described to the agent and approved into your vault.
